VinFast, the Vietnamese electric vehicle (EV) manufacturer, has launched its latest model, the VF 3 mini SUV, aiming to make electric cars more accessible with a starting price of just 322 million dong (£10,000). The company plans to deliver at least 20,000 units within the year.

The VF 3, a compact SUV measuring 3.2 meters in length and under 1.7 meters in width, offers a range of 215 kilometers on a single charge. The vehicle’s compact size makes it particularly suited for younger drivers navigating the narrow roads and alleys common in urban areas like Hanoi.

When VinFast opened reservations for the VF 3 in May, the response was overwhelming, with nearly 28,000 orders placed within just 66 hours.

According to VinFast, the VF 3 is becoming a popular choice for families who already own a larger vehicle and are looking for a second car. Initially available in Vietnam, the company plans to expand sales to the Philippines and other markets in the future.

VinFast, a subsidiary of the Vingroup conglomerate, has ambitious goals for its EV sales, targeting 80,000 units for 2024. This target, while already impressive, was initially set at 100,000 units but was later revised.

The VF 3 represents VinFast’s commitment to expanding the EV market with affordable options, aiming to cater to the growing demand for environmentally friendly vehicles in densely populated urban areas.
